On Raffl, the cancellation of a raffle and the ensuing withdrawal process is handled by smart contracts and is largely automated. The only scenario under which a raffle can be cancelled is if it does not meet the minimum entries requirement by the deadline.

When a raffle is cancelled, it automatically enters a refund stage. The smart contract will allow both participants and the raffle creator to request the refund of their entries and prizes respectively.

It’s important to note that neither participants nor the raffle creator can manually cancel a withdrawal once the refund stage has started. This process is governed by the rules of the smart contract to ensure fairness and transparency.
